SMILE Eye Surgical Procedure Introduction



If you're taking into consideration SMILE eye surgical procedure, you'll locate it to be a minimally invasive treatment with a quick recuperation time. During SMILE (Tiny Cut Lenticule Extraction), a laser is utilized to develop a little, accurate laceration in the cornea to eliminate a small item of cells, reshaping it to remedy your vision. This varies from LASIK, where a flap is developed, and PRK, where the outer layer of the cornea is totally removed.

Among the essential benefits of SMILE is its minimally intrusive nature, causing a faster healing process and much less pain post-surgery. The recuperation time for SMILE is fairly fast, with many clients experiencing enhanced vision within a day or 2. This makes it a popular choice for those seeking a practical and efficient vision modification treatment. Additionally, SMILE has been shown to have a reduced threat of dry eye syndrome compared to LASIK, making it a favorable choice for people concerned about this prospective side effect.

Distinctions In Between SMILE, LASIK, and PRK



When contrasting S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ical procedures, it is essential to understand the unique methods utilized in each procedure for vision adjustment.

SMILE (Little Incision Lenticule Extraction) is a minimally invasive procedure that includes developing a small cut to draw out a lenticule from the cornea, reshaping it to deal with vision.

LASIK (Laser-Assisted In Situ Keratomileusis) entails producing a slim flap on the cornea, utilizing a laser to improve the underlying cells, and afterwards rearranging the flap.

P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) eliminates the outer layer of the cornea before reshaping the tissue with a laser.

The major difference lies in the means the cornea is accessed and dealt with. SMILE is flapless, making it an excellent choice for individuals with slim corneas or those involved in contact sports. LASIK uses rapid visual healing as a result of the flap production, yet it may position a higher threat of flap-related issues. PRK, although having a longer healing duration, avoids flap-related concerns completely.

Benefits And Drawbacks Comparison



To evaluate the advantages and downsides of S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geries, it's important to consider the details advantages and possible restrictions of each procedure. SMILE surgery provides the advantage of a minimally invasive procedure, with a smaller sized cut and potentially quicker recovery time compared to LASIK and PRK. It likewise minimizes the threat of completely dry eye post-surgery, a typical adverse effects of LASIK. Nonetheless, SMILE may have constraints in treating higher levels of myopia or astigmatism contrasted to LASIK.

LASIK surgery supplies rapid aesthetic recuperation and very little discomfort throughout the treatment. It's extremely efficient in dealing with a wide range of refractive errors, consisting of nearsightedness, hyperopia, and astigmatism. PRK eye surgical procedure, while not as popular as LASIK, prevents developing a corneal flap, reducing the risk of flap-related difficulties. It appropriates for individuals with thin corneas or irregular corneal surface areas. Nevertheless, PRK has a much longer healing time and may entail extra pain throughout the healing procedure.
